Kyle Joseph Kistner, co-founder of the decentralized lending platform bZx, tweeted that for CFTC compliance considerations, Coinbase will suspend its margin trading services. This is an incredibly good news for DeFi. The decision puts custodial services in a dilemma.  The CFTC is saying that only DeFi will be allowed to provide margin trading services. This very much mirrors regulatory trends favoring non-custodial over custodial services. This mirrors larger regulatory trends that are promoting the development of non-custodial services.
